Large independent studio. Superb peaceful setting, stunning views.

The studio has lovely south-facing views over a courtyard towards the hillsides opposite. At the end of a no-through lane, it is in a peaceful hamlet setting. The owners, (who both work) are on hand in the old farmhouse and are happy to advise and assist if required.

Whilst the studio is entirely independent with its own sitting out area, guests are also welcome to use the gardens and grounds (2 hectares). The view is panoramic and has inspired photographers and artists alike as the light and colours change throughout the day and seasons.

The studio comprises a small entrance, a shower-room (large shower, vanity unit, WC, heated towel rail). The large main room (40m²) has a fitted kitchen area with garden door, living/dining area. The bedroom area has a king-size bed (180cm which can be separated to make two single beds, if preferred).
For cooler evenings, there is a wood-pellet burning stove, simple to operate.

This is a perfect spot for doing absolutely nothing, on a chaise longue with a book and a pair of binoculars to admire the remarkable birdlife. There are woodland walks on the doorstep if a little activity is called for.

For sight-seeing purposes, it is strategically located in the centre of the Dordogne. Motorway access at 15 minutes makes Bordeaux centre reachable in about 1h15.

Périgueux, the county town is a 20 minute run and full of interest with its roman ruins (arena, villa-museum) and superbly renovated renaissance quarter. The celebrated mime festival (“Mimos”) takes place annually in Périgueux (2020: 29 July to 2 Aug), as does the New Orleans Jazz festival (“MNOP”). You can also enjoy the (free) jazz/blues/swing concerts held in the various squares in the old town (“Macadam Jazz”).
The “Bandas” festival in St Astier (July) is worth a mention as thousands flock to hear a number of brass bands as they parade and play in the streets.

Bergerac airport is 30 minutes away. Brantôme, Les Eyzies and Le Bugue are 35 minutes away, Sarlat 1hr.
